Job Description for Associate Director of Student Ministry | Programming and Sunday Morning - Westheimer Campus

Supervisor: Director of Student Ministry

EXEMPT: Full Time

Flexible Schedule (M-Th 8:30 - 5:00, Sun 8:00 - 8:00)

Overall Responsibility 

The Associate Director of Student Ministry works with student ministry staff and volunteers to design and implement student ministry programs and ministries while providing Christian guidance to students and volunteers. This role requires an individual to have leadership, collaborative, and communication gifts. 

Prerequisites for hire:

  • Leads from a core of spiritual health and wholeness with spiritual maturity and a strong passion for ministry
  • At least 4 years of experience as a student ministries intern or staff member
  • College graduate
  • Demonstrated ability to work in teams, maintain flexibility, and execute goals while collaborating in a team environment

Ideal Candidate

  • Spiritual Depth:
  • Some post-graduate seminary education
  • Experience leading and managing a team
  • Familiarity with AV/Tech systems

Essential Job Functions:

Oversee Sunday Morning Student Ministry & Production

  • Ensure that Sunday morning and event environments are welcoming, energetic, and engaging for students
  • Oversee the worship culture (Band/Music) and production environment (Tech/AV) for all student gatherings.

Volunteer Strategy and Recruitment

  • Help design and execute the year-round strategy to identify and recruit volunteers for Sunday mornings and events
  • Recruit, equip, and train a team of volunteer leaders to execute programming logistics.
  • Coordinate volunteers specifically for individual events and weekly programming.

Major Event Operations & Logistics

  • Direct the planning and logistics for large-scale events, retreats, Sunday Night Programming, and service projects.
  • Work with the student ministry staff to ensure all preparation needs ("nuts and bolts") have been completed prior to events.
  • Collaborate with key staff members on operational details, including contracts, travel arrangements, and event budgets.

Ministry Partnerships

  • Serve as the key partner and liaison for external ministries with which St. Luke’s partners, including Scouts, Young Life, and Ozone
  • Work with the student ministry administrative assistant to coordinate usage of shared spaces and resources with these partners.

General Student Ministry Team

  • Help design and execute a proactive student and family engagement strategy, ensuring consistent and personal follow-up with disconnected students and families.
  • Participate in student leadership initiatives as a trainer and discipler.
  • Attend student ministry and church staff team meetings.
  • Participate in the shared rotation of teaching or announcements as needed.
  • Offer general assistance in any area of the church's ministry where talents and abilities are requested.

Skills and Attributes

  • Lead from a core of spiritual health and wholeness
  • Balance time, understanding the importance of self and family care
  • Be a model for incarnational and relational ministry during student ministry programs
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Computer, AV, and internet skills
  • Diplomacy in relationships
  • Organizational skills to oversee complicated event logistics and the ability to keep the ministry calendar.
